Actually, m.a. was not the first, only one of the first. Stiletto was first, followed by Gala, Potomac Pride and Crested Surf. The deal with m. a., at least in my garden is that once it emerges, it just explodes - shoots up and unfurls almost overnight.  The first little green nubs I saw were in mid-Feb, and that was Aphrodite. After sticking her nose out in the cold, though, she sat and didn't emerge much further til last week.
